If you didn’t receive an email don’t forgot to verify your spam folder, in any other case contact help. We do every thing to guarantee that the costs on the website are appropriate nonetheless we reserve the proper to change our prices at any time with out further discover. His ardour lies in writing articles on the most popular IT platforms including Machine learning, DevOps, Knowledge Science, Synthetic Intelligence, RPA, Deep Learning, and so forth. You can keep up to date on all these applied sciences by following him on LinkedIn and Twitter. VCS trigger detects the changes in the VCS repository and Schedule set off is used to schedule your build at common intervals.
You can seamlessly customise TeamCity’s interface to match your necessities.For Jenkins, performance comes before look. However if your team is massive on ease of use, we suggest you give TeamCity a chance. Overall, both TeamCity and Jenkins have simple setup, set up, and configuration processes. There are still more answers to ‘Why TeamCity.’ It helps the .Web framework and is an exceptionally dependable tool for freshers getting into DevOps; you’ll find a way to run it on any OS of your alternative. It has an in-built construct artifact repository to retailer artifacts on the TeamCity server file system or external storage.
Fixing Unreal Engine Project Points With Qodana
In addition, the device allows you to construct docker photographs simply, and integration with Jira and Bugzilla enables you to observe and report issues. TeamCity was launched in 2006 by JetBrains, an organization recognized for creating software program improvement tools like ReSharper, WebStorm and PyCharm, in addition to the built-in improvement environment IntelliJ IDEA. The automation tool was JetBrains’ introduction to the continual integration and steady delivery market, and it now boasts over 30,000 prospects that embody groups of all sizes throughout various industries. TeamCity is a reliable answer that can assist these efforts by providing seamless integration of DAST tools into CI/CD pipelines. Its complete set of options, similar to automated testing and detailed build insights, empowers groups to detect and remediate vulnerabilities efficiently. With TeamCity, organizations can strengthen their safety posture without compromising improvement speed or agility.
Every construct step is represented by a construct runner providing integration with a selected construct device (like Ant, Gradle, MSBuild, and so on), a testing framework (for instance, NUnit), or a code evaluation engine. Thus, in a single construct you can have several steps and sequentially invoke check tools, code protection, and, for instance, compile your project. Combining DAST with SAST permits teams to establish each static and runtime vulnerabilities, guaranteeing a more detailed risk evaluation.
Teamcity
- It further reduces code integration issues and makes teamwork more practical and easy.
- In Contrast to IAST, DAST is much less invasive, because it doesn’t require integration into the application’s codebase or runtime surroundings, nor does it contain deploying sensors into the source code.
- You can choose Jenkins when you don’t need to go through this complete configuration for internet hosting TeamCity.
- For instance, early-stage issues detected by SAST can be resolved before reaching runtime, lowering the scope of vulnerabilities flagged during DAST scans.
TeamCity is a CI/CD solution that integrates DAST into CI/CD pipelines, embedding safety testing instantly into the development workflow. The Professional on-premises plan presents limitless users and construct time, a hundred Chatbot construct configurations and help by way of the forum and issue tracker. The Enterprise on-premises plan presents limitless customers, construct time and construct configurations. It also comes with technical assist should you have any issues when utilizing the construct automation tool. TeamCity is an all-purpose steady integration, steady supply, and steady deployment software for DevOps teams.
Most putting was how Philadelphia cruised to victory while hardly ever needing its star running back, Saquon Barkley, to deliver the kind of huge plays that had helped the Eagles advance to the Super Bowl in the first place. Philadelphia’s oft-criticized passing game turned a one-sided sport right into a blowout. Regular scans help you stay forward of rising threats and confirm that updates or new features of the application don’t introduce safety gaps. For instance https://www.globalcloudteam.com/, a runtime vulnerability like exposing delicate knowledge in API responses or failing to invalidate a session after logout could go unnoticed in static analysis but can be detected by DAST. Not Like SAST, which focuses on inside code structure, DAST evaluates the application from an external perspective, making it indispensable for detecting vulnerabilities that arise solely during execution. TeamCity also helps parallelism, however it’s pretty powerful for customers to implement.
Fundamental Ci Workflow In Teamcity
Upon completion of the construct, TeamCity stores the resulting recordsdata, termed build artifacts, in a repository. These artifacts embody parts like the compiled code, take a look at outcomes, and deployment packages. For instance, a VCS set off will mechanically start a new build every time TeamCity detects a change in the configured VCS roots. The complete record of supported platforms and environments is available here. So, what occurs to unsold merchandise after the playoff video games and the Super Bowl?
It has a extremely dynamic community that helps in data static code analyzer sharing and downside sharing, particularly round basic matters and plug-ins development. On the opposite hand, Jenkins has a well-documented information and an energetic neighborhood. Right Here instruments assist, two of which are TeamCity and Jenkins—our matter of the day. Update to the newest model for applying the newest enhancements and safety fixes.
Combining DAST with instruments like SAST and IAST creates a layered security approach that maximizes visibility and optimizes remediation efforts. Integrating DAST with different safety testing efforts enhances an organization’s safety posture by addressing vulnerabilities at different phases of the software improvement lifecycle. While DAST excels at runtime testing, different methods like SAST and IAST tackle totally different stages of the event lifecycle. SAST analyzes supply code before execution, serving to builders catch issues early throughout coding (this approach is also called shift-left).
It is a Java-based CI server that provides build chain instruments, source management, and detailed build history, features you’ll probably miss in free tools. Although it runs in a Java setting, you’ll be able to nonetheless set up it on multiple OS, such as Home Windows and Linux. Automating builds, checks, and deployments allows TeamCity to embed DAST scans at key stages of the software development lifecycle. Its integration capabilities prolong to popular DAST tools, guaranteeing safety testing runs alongside different CI/CD actions without disrupting productivity. With thousands of in-built plug-ins, Jenkins emerges not solely as a code-building device but also as a code-testing tool. There is support for multiple version management methods and construct environments besides only some.TeamCity provides extra than simply the fundamental features of a CI device.
Within the bigger image of safety testing methodologies, DAST stands out for concentrating on the operational state of functions and APIs. The change in SDLC processes has given rise to steady integration and delivery (CI/CD) setting, and every organization realizes its benefits. What they need, together with CI/CD, are instruments supporting this idea, two of that are TeamCity and Jenkins.